What are the eligibility requirements for this tender?

The eligibility requirements include being a registered entity, having a minimum average annual turnover of 70 lakh, and evidence of past performance being at least 30% concerning related product supplies. Bidders wishing to apply for exemptions must provide supporting documents for review.
